Testing is a crucial aspect in the development process. It goes beyond simply confirming that software functions as expected. True testing involves meticulously uncovering potential flaws and enhancing the overall quality of a product. By pinpointing these issues early on, developers can resolve them before they impact users, consequently leading to a smoother and more enjoyable experience.

Approaches for Test Automation: Streamlining the Testing Process

Efficient software testing relies heavily on automation. By integrating effective test automation strategies, development teams can significantly improve the speed, accuracy, and coverage of their testing efforts. These strategies often involve leveraging specialized tools to perform repetitive tasks, allowing testers to focus on more sophisticated aspects of the testing process. Key elements of successful test automation encompass well-defined test scripts, robust infrastructure selection, and continuous evaluation to ensure optimal performance.
